Output d5907c121834a354fa6ab534d7e713b5d7c6fae2aed226c71f0ed16f0a0be8e5:1

value
728415083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53a475cbe42e48f27362edb273ebf5b0103e8007 OP_EQUAL
address
MFXRLF49k9FVJPofmegv8w4uKiPVLgsUiA
transaction
d5907c121834a354fa6ab534d7e713b5d7c6fae2aed226c71f0ed16f0a0be8e5
spent
true